Formed in 1959, the Smith County Historical Society is a non-profit 501(c)3 orgranization dedicated to the preservation of Smith County history. Membership is open to all interested parties.

The Tyler Doll Club meets every fourth Tuesday of each month, except for special meetings which are announced at the club meeting. Meetings are held at the Briarcliff meeting room at 7 pm. Club holds a doll show in conjunction with the Rose Festival. Proceeds are given to charity.
